org.eclipse.stardust.engine.api.query
Class ProcessInstanceDetailsPolicy

java.lang.Object
  extended by org.eclipse.stardust.engine.api.query.ProcessInstanceDetailsPolicy
All Implemented Interfaces:
Serializable, EvaluationPolicy

public class ProcessInstanceDetailsPolicy
extends Object
implements EvaluationPolicy

Evaluation policy affecting the level of details for process instances.

Author:
born
See Also:
Serialized Form

Constructor Summary
ProcessInstanceDetailsPolicy(ProcessInstanceDetailsLevel level)
           
ProcessInstanceDetailsPolicy(ProcessInstanceDetailsLevel level, EnumSet<ProcessInstanceDetailsOptions> options)
           
 
Method Summary
 ProcessInstanceDetailsLevel getLevel()
           
 EnumSet<ProcessInstanceDetailsOptions> getOptions()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ProcessInstanceDetailsPolicy

public ProcessInstanceDetailsPolicy(ProcessInstanceDetailsLevel level)

ProcessInstanceDetailsPolicy

public ProcessInstanceDetailsPolicy(ProcessInstanceDetailsLevel level,
                                    EnumSet<ProcessInstanceDetailsOptions> options)
Method Detail

getOptions

public EnumSet<ProcessInstanceDetailsOptions> getOptions()
Returns:
the set of details options. Altering the returned set will alter the policy as well.

getLevel

public ProcessInstanceDetailsLevel getLevel()


Copyright © 2017 Eclipse Stardust. All Rights Reserved.